Subject: [PATCH 4/4] dt-bindings: dwmac: Add bindings for new Loongson SoC and bridge chip
Date: Fri, 18 Jun 2021 10:53:37 +0800	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20210618025337.5705-4-zhangqing@loongson.cn>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20210618025337.5705-1-zhangqing@loongson.cn>

Add the dwmac bindings for the Loongson-2K SoC and the LS7A
bridge chip.

Signed-off-by: Qing Zhang <zhangqing@loongson.cn>
---
 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/snps,dwmac.yaml | 6 ++++++
 1 file changed, 6 insertions(+)

diff --git a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/snps,dwmac.yaml b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/snps,dwmac.yaml
index 2edd8bea993e..9631bbbb6f69 100644
--- a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/snps,dwmac.yaml
+++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/snps,dwmac.yaml
@@ -56,6 +56,8 @@ properties:
         - amlogic,meson8m2-dwmac
         - amlogic,meson-gxbb-dwmac
         - amlogic,meson-axg-dwmac
+        - loongson,ls2k-dwmac
+        - loongson,ls7a-dwmac
         - rockchip,px30-gmac
         - rockchip,rk3128-gmac
         - rockchip,rk3228-gmac
@@ -310,6 +312,8 @@ allOf:
               - allwinner,sun8i-r40-emac
               - allwinner,sun8i-v3s-emac
               - allwinner,sun50i-a64-emac
+              - loongson,ls2k-dwmac
+              - loongson,ls7a-dwmac
               - snps,dwxgmac
               - snps,dwxgmac-2.10
               - st,spear600-gmac
@@ -353,6 +357,8 @@ allOf:
               - allwinner,sun8i-r40-emac
               - allwinner,sun8i-v3s-emac
               - allwinner,sun50i-a64-emac
+              - loongson,ls2k-dwmac
+              - loongson,ls7a-dwmac
               - snps,dwmac-4.00
               - snps,dwmac-4.10a
               - snps,dwmac-4.20a
